The Provincial Statutes of Lower Canada Volume 2, published in 1797, is a collection of laws and regulations passed by the provincial government of Lower Canada (now Quebec). The book contains a comprehensive list of statutes, including those related to civil and criminal law, taxation, commerce, and public works. The statutes are organized by subject matter, with each section providing a brief introduction to the relevant laws. The book also includes a detailed index, making it easy for readers to find specific laws and regulations.
